Stelfox is supporting one of our financial services clients in recruiting a Performance engineer to join a local performance engineering team in Ireland, that ensure all their software and IT applications are performant, reliable and scalable across the organisation.
As a performance engineer, you will be responsible for:
Planning, defining & execution of performance testing strategies and solutions.
Design & implement performance testing scripts and tools.
Identifying and troubleshooting application performance issues, providing resolution recommendations to development teams.
Participate in validation of software releases and hardware upgrades.
Communicate with Application Development team on application performance issues.
Be part of shift left performance testing in the CI/CD pipeline delivery
Work with DevOps team to identify and verify tuning enhancements for applications
Assist in triage of production performance issues in a fast and efficient manner
We are looking for an individual who can take on the responsibility of performance testing engagements and troubleshoot performance issues from the outset.
You will need experience with the following:
8-10+ years of experience in Performance Engineering or equivalent role.
LoadRunner, NeoLoad, JMeter, Selenium or similar test automation tools
Application Performance Management tool experience, such as: Broadcom DXI O2, Dynatrace, AppDynamics, New Relic
Experience in analysis of production data and modelling of realistic test scenarios
Ability to build custom tooling to streamline work processes
Analysis of and identification of performance issues in Java applications, Containerized and serverless environments
Knowledge of Cloud Computing, specifically AWS
Experience in troubleshooting network performance issues
Trend analysis of Performance testing results
An understanding of security principles and implementing these in performance testing
Experience with CI/DI tools such as CDD and Jenkins, specifically with integrating performance testing into pipelines.
